Factors That Affect Price
Price varies with scope, site, and finish level. Major cost drivers include foundation requirements for the addition, structural integration with existing walls, the pitch and complexity of the roof, HVAC and electrical system upgrades, and the quality of interior finishes. Notable thresholds include HVAC size, which can add thousands when a new system is required, and roof complexity, where steep pitches or multiple angles can raise scaffold and material costs. Roof age and integration with existing permits also influence prices.
Ways To Save
Smart planning reduces costs without sacrificing core value. Consider phasing the project, selecting standard finishes, and coordinating trades to minimize site downtime. Early design decisions on window placement, insulation strategy, and ceiling height can reduce framing and finish costs. A well-defined scope reduces change orders, while obtaining multiple bids helps identify competitive pricing. Budget buffers of 10–20% are prudent for unforeseen site conditions.
Regional Price Differences
Location affects pricing due to labor markets and land costs. Three broad U S regional comparisons illustrate typical deltas. In the Northeast urban core, higher labor costs and permitting fees push averages toward the upper end. In the Midwest suburban zones, costs tend to be mid-range with steady trade availability. In many rural areas, material shipping and smaller crews can keep prices lower, though weather and access may raise totals. Variations are commonly ±10% to ±25% from national averages depending on exact city, county, and utility constraints.
Labor & Installation Time
Labor time directly maps to cost and project risk. A typical add-on requires 4–12 weeks of on-site work depending on size. Smaller bump-outs may stay under 6 weeks, while second-story expansions often exceed 12 weeks with staged trades. Labor rates range roughly from $40–$120 per hour for skilled trades in most markets. Longer duration increases the exposure to change orders and weather delays, which adds to the total cost.
Additional & Hidden Costs
Hidden costs frequently surface and affect final pricing. Ask about site preparation surprises, such as drainage changes or soil testing. Hidden costs may include temporary utilities, temporary HVAC, or security measures during construction. Exterior finishes and interior trim upgrades can push totals unexpectedly. Climate-related delays, insurance adjustments, and contractor overhead may also appear as line items that are easy to overlook in early estimates.

Maintenance & Ownership Costs
Long-term costs matter as much as upfront price. A home addition can alter maintenance budgets and operating costs. Expect higher heating and cooling loads if the addition changes the building envelope and insulation performance. Routine upkeep for expanded spaces, potential future remodels, and roof life considerations should be planned for in the 5-year cost outlook. A well-insulated, properly air-sealed addition often reduces ongoing energy spend and increases resale value.
Seasonality & Price Trends
Prices shift with seasonal demand and supply chain effects. Most contractors experience slower winter workloads but may charge a premium for winter work due to weather risks. Spring and summer can see busier schedules and higher material costs from demand spikes. Off-season planning with pre-bid design and permitting often yields modest savings and more scheduling flexibility.
Permits, Codes & Rebates
Compliance costs and potential incentives shape the bottom line. Permit fees vary by jurisdiction and project type; some regions offer rebates for energy-efficient upgrades or green certifications. The permitting process may also require plan reviews, which extend timelines. Builders sometimes factor permit contingencies into the contract, so readers should verify what is included and what is charged separately.
